  8. One month that I have a lot of good memories from that doesn’t get a lot of mention is April 2015. For me it was the sunniest April on record until 2021, it had a maximum above average but also had a lot of cool nights with minima below average (my favourite combination in spring) and a lot of good spring weather. I remember Easter weekend being very pleasant that year with a high of 19.3.C on Easter Sunday (5th) then a high of 18.9.C on Easter Monday. The good weather lasted the rest of that week before shifting to something a bit more unsettled with some notable hail on the 11th but it still remained rather sunny. There was then another pretty warm spell from the 19th-24th reaching a high of 21.1.C on the 22nd. The last week turned rather unsettled and quite wet and that was the pattern that may 2015 followed. A month with not the warmth of 2007 and 2011 but for many places had higher sunshine totals. As my stats it certainly didn’t have a mean temperature of anything spectacular but had significantly warmer maximums

    Stats 

    Mean maximum: 14.4.C (+1.7.C)

    Mean minimum: 2.2.C (-1.4.C)

    Mean: 8.3.C (+0.2.C)

    Rainfall: 27mm (62%)

    Sunshine: 215 hours (147%)

  12. One summer that I will never forget for the wrong reasons - Summer 2012. I have never experienced a summer so poor and I hope I never experience a summer so bad again. What is everyone’s memories of this summer and have you recorded a worse summer or remember any worse.

    June - An absolute borefest and so cold. Maximum temperatures were nearly 3.C below average for me and it was by far the coldest June I have recorded. There was five days the whole month where it was dry, sunny and settled all day and that was the 2nd, 4th, 18th, 19th and 20th. The rest of the month was cold, wet and very windy. It genuinely felt like October most of the time. The only saving grace it wasn’t exceptionally wet, it was the fifth wettest I’ve recorded since 1999. 2002, 2004, 2007 and 2017 were all wetter. We missed out on the brief hot spell on the 28th with just more of the same steady rainfall and relentless cloud.

    July - Continued pretty much exactly from where July left off there was a brief respite between the 4th-6th with some slightly better weather but nothing worthy to note. Then the bad weather restarted again by the 7th and this continued until the 23rd, more Atlantic rubbish, temperatures barely getting to the mid teens, wet, overcast with only brief sunny periods. The weather did somewhat improve by the 24th but again we missed out on the heat. The closing days were again slightly better than the rest of the month but still rubbish.

    August - Continued unsettled but thankfully not on the scale of June and July and weirdly the warmest and driest weather of the whole summer was during this spell. Spells from 4th-8th, 10th-13th, 17th-21st, were all pretty good temperatures getting into the mid 20’s and with plenty sunshine. Aside from those periods though the weather was still pretty wet and cloudy but thankfully a little bit warmer.
     

    Definitely the worst summer I can remember and I hope to god we never get a summer that bad ever again some notable stats during this season. Particularly with maximum temperatures, well below average except in August. Rainfall well above average in all months and sunshine well below average expect in August.

    Highest maximum temperatures

    June: 20.2.C (20th) (average: 25.1.C) 4.9.C below average

    July: 22.4.C (25th) (average: 26.6.C) 4.2.C below average

    August: 24.7.C (11th) (average: 24.9.C) 0.2.C below average 

    Mean maximum 
    June: 15.4.C (average: 18.3.C) 2.9.C below average 

    July: 17.9.C (average 20.1.C) 2.2.C below average 

    August: 19.3.C (average 19.5.C) 0.2 below average 

    Overall: 17.5.C (average 19.3.C ) 1.8.C below average

    Rainfall 

    June: 101mm (158% of average)

    July: 138mm (171% of average)

    August: 107mm (129% of average)

    Overall: 346mm (153% of average)

    Sunshine

    June: 107 hours (65% of average)

    July: 99 hours (57% of average)

    August: 143 hours (93% of average)

    Overall: 349 hours (72% of average)
